Experts can please confirm but my understanding is that there will be increasing numbers of slots for women in the submarine fleet. There are at-present specific subs that have "accommodations" (living and bathroom facilities) to house female and male crew members on the same sub, and some subs that at-present do not. A recent article stated enlisted women currently serve aboard four guided-missile submarines and one ballistic-missile submarine, that means the majority of active subs are male-only staffed until changes are made/ new subs enter into service.

It's been stated that female crew slots will increase as additional subs come online. Specifically, guided-missile submarines (SSGN) and ballistic missile submarines (SSBN) (boomers) at present have female crew enablement (can have female crew - I don't know the current roster of each sub). Going forward, all future Columbia-class ballistic missile submarines and all Virginia-class fast attack submarines, starting with the USS New Jersey (SSN 796), will have enlisted women options in their crews. The U.S.S. Wyoming is the only sub that as of a few months ago went to sea with an female crew. Perhaps more subs may soon have all female crews with the existing setups, which would open up even more opportunities for female sub officers and crew.
